Windows 11 Facing Criticism
It seems like Microsoft's latest operating system, Windows 11, is not living up to expectations. According to a scathing report by Gizmodo, Windows 11 is drowning in a sea of issues, ranging from bugs to security vulnerabilities. The article titled "There’s No Saving Windows 11. It’s Time for Windows 12" highlights the challenges that Windows 11 is currently facing. The team at Gizmodo argues that the problems with Windows 11 are so severe that a new version, Windows 12, may be the only solution.
